The Role of Oven Light Bulbs in Cooking Appliances

Oven light bulbs serve the primary function of illuminating the interior of the oven, allowing users to monitor the cooking process without opening the door. This visibility is critical for ensuring food is cooked properly and helps maintain the oven's internal temperature by reducing the need to open the door frequently. The Oven Light Bulb thus contributes to energy efficiency and consistent cooking results.

In addition to practical considerations, the oven light bulb enhances safety by providing clear visibility, reducing the risk of accidents when handling hot cookware. Given the high-stakes environment of heat and potential hazards, the bulb's reliability is paramount.

Characteristics of Oven Light Bulbs

High-Temperature Resistance

One of the defining features of an oven light bulb is its ability to withstand extreme temperatures. Standard light bulbs are not designed for such conditions and would fail quickly if used in an oven. Oven light bulbs are typically made with heat-resistant materials, such as soda-lime or borosilicate glass, which can endure temperatures up to 300°C (572°F) or more. The filament and other internal components are also constructed to tolerate these high temperatures without degrading rapidly.

Specific Socket Types

Oven light bulbs often come with specific base types that are suited for oven fixtures. Common bases include the E14 and E26/E27 screw types, as well as G9 and bayonet mounts. These bases are designed to secure the bulb firmly, ensuring good electrical contact even in the high-vibration environment of an oven. The compatibility with oven sockets is a crucial consideration when selecting a replacement bulb.

Voltage and Wattage Considerations

Oven light bulbs are available in various voltages and wattages to match the specifications of different ovens. Common wattages include 15W, 25W, and 40W, which provide sufficient illumination without excessive heat generation. The voltage must match the appliance's requirements—typically 120V or 240V in residential settings. Using a bulb with incorrect voltage or wattage can result in suboptimal performance or pose safety risks.

Differences Between Oven Light Bulbs and Regular Light Bulbs

Material Composition

The materials used in oven light bulbs are significantly different from those in standard bulbs. Oven bulbs use heat-resistant glass and metals that do not degrade at high temperatures. For instance, the filament is often made of tungsten, which has a high melting point of about 3422°C. The use of robust materials ensures longevity and reliability under harsh conditions.

Thermal Performance

Regular light bulbs are designed for ambient temperature conditions and cannot handle the thermal stresses inside an oven. Oven light bulbs are engineered to disperse heat efficiently and avoid thermal shock. This thermal performance is critical to prevent bulb failure, which could lead to glass breakage and contamination of food.

Safety Features

Safety is a paramount concern in oven bulb design. Features such as reinforced glass envelopes, secure bases, and durable filaments reduce the risk of electrical shorts and fires. Additionally, oven light bulbs comply with strict safety standards and certifications, providing assurance to consumers about their reliability.

Advancements in Oven Light Bulb Technology

Recent developments have seen the introduction of LED oven light bulbs. These bulbs offer increased energy efficiency, longer lifespans, and improved durability. LED bulbs generate less heat, reducing the thermal load inside the oven, which can contribute to better energy efficiency overall. However, they must still be designed specifically for high-temperature environments to be suitable for oven use.

The transition to LED technology reflects a broader trend in lighting but presents unique challenges in oven applications. The materials and electronics must be carefully engineered to handle temperature extremes. Ongoing research aims to enhance the reliability and performance of LED oven bulbs, making them a viable replacement for traditional incandescent bulbs.

Practical Advice for Consumers

When replacing an oven light bulb, consumers should first consult the oven's manual to identify the correct bulb type. It's advisable to purchase bulbs from reputable suppliers and ensure that the product specifications match the oven's requirements. If uncertain, seeking professional assistance can prevent potential hazards.

Regular maintenance checks can also prolong the life of the oven light bulb. Ensuring that the bulb is securely fitted and that the socket is free from debris can enhance performance. Additionally, being cautious when cleaning the oven to avoid damaging the bulb or its housing can contribute to its longevity.
